Scanning To change a button's settings before starting to scan, see the section "Selecting New Settings for a Button" on page 36. If you make changes in the One Touch Properties window, then click the Apply button, the information in the One Touch panel will update to show the new settings. To Refresh the One Touch 4.0 settings, click the Refresh button on the One Touch Properties window. 3. When you're ready to scan, just click (not right-click) a button on the Button Panel. NOTE: The One Touch Properties window must be closed before you can scan from the Button Panel. NOTE: Your scanner comes with nine factory-preset One Touch button settings. You can reconfigure and rename the buttons for your specific scanning requirements. See "The Default One Touch Settings for Your Scanner" on page 32 for the factory presets.
